    In need of humidity advice please!!

    Covering the screen top is going to be your best bet. Try using either aluminum foil or plexiglass with a spot open for either of your lamps. There's a really good thread on here about setting up a glass enclosure to hold heat and humidity well. Can't think of the thread title at the moment
